NU Online News Service, March 29, 2004, 5:23 p.m. EST – USAA, San Antonio, has named Kristi Matus president of its USAA Life Insurance Company unit.[@@]

Matus succeeds James Middleton, who has retired after serving as president of USAA Life for 4 years.

Matus has been vice president of products and regulatory management for USAA Life since 2002. She previously was chief operating officer of Thrivent Financial Bank, Appleton, Wis. She also has been a Medicare supplement actuary and product manager.

Matus has a bachelor’s degree from the University of Wisconsin in Oshkosh.
